Effect of butachlor (G) on soil enzyme activity

Soil enzymes play a crucial role in maintaining soil functions. Pesticide application to crop plants can potentially interfere with soil enzyme activity. We evaluated the impact of butachlor (G), a widely used herbicide, on total soil microbial activity and activity of various soil enzymes, including alkaline phosphatase, protease, urease and amidase at different application rates under flooded and un-flooded conditions in a laboratory experiment. The pesticide treatment had an inhibitory effect on dehydrogenase activity under un-flooded conditions and stimulatory effect under flooded conditions. Phosphatase activity was stimulated under most of the applied concentrations both under flooded as well as un-flooded conditions. Protease activity was initially stimulated but decreased towards the end of the experiment under un-flooded conditions. Under flooded conditions the effect of butachlor on the activity of protease was stimulatory. Urease activity was reduced by pesticide treatment under un-flooded conditions, but response was inconsistent under flooded conditions. Amidase activity showed a fluctuating behaviour. Thus, the results allowed us to conclude that the use of butachlor alters soil enzyme activity, and its potential implications could be examined by future studies.
